【Sniffer安装教程】在当今信息化高速发展的时代,网络数据的安全性和监控能力显得尤为重要。作为网络分析和故障排查的重要工具之一,Sniffer(网络嗅探器)在很多技术场景中被广泛应用。本文将详细介绍如何在不同操作系统上安装和配置Sniffer工具,帮助用户快速上手并掌握其基本功能。
一、什么是Sniffer?
Sniffer是一种能够捕获和分析网络流量的软件工具。它通过监听网络接口上的数据包,将原始数据进行解析,从而帮助技术人员了解网络通信过程、检测异常流量、排查网络问题等。常见的Sniffer工具有Wireshark、tcpdump、Ettercap等,它们各有特点,适用于不同的使用场景。
二、选择合适的Sniffer工具
在开始安装之前,首先需要根据自身需求选择合适的Sniffer工具。例如:
- Wireshark:功能强大,支持图形界面,适合初学者和高级用户。
- tcpdump:命令行工具,轻量级且高效,适合服务器环境。
- Ettercap:具备中间人攻击功能,常用于网络安全测试。
根据实际应用场景选择合适的工具,可以提升工作效率。
三、Windows系统下Sniffer安装步骤
以Wireshark为例,介绍在Windows平台上的安装流程:
1. 下载安装包
访问Wireshark官网(https://www.wireshark.org),选择对应版本的安装文件进行下载。
2. 运行安装程序
双击下载的安装文件,按照提示完成安装。建议勾选“Install Npcap”选项,以便更高效地捕获网络数据。
3. 启动Wireshark
安装完成后,在桌面或开始菜单中找到Wireshark图标并打开。首次运行时可能需要管理员权限。
4. 选择网络接口
在主界面中选择需要监听的网络适配器,点击“开始”按钮即可开始抓包。
四、Linux系统下Sniffer安装步骤
对于Linux用户,以tcpdump为例:
1. 更新系统包列表
打开终端,输入以下命令:
```
sudo apt update
```
2. 安装tcpdump
输入以下命令进行安装:
```
sudo apt install tcpdump
```
3. 使用tcpdump抓包
安装完成后,可以使用如下命令进行抓包:
```
sudo tcpdump -i eth0
```
其中`eth0`为网络接口名称,可根据实际情况修改。
五、常见问题与解决方法
- 权限不足:在Linux中使用tcpdump时,可能需要使用`sudo`来获取权限。
- 无法捕获数据包:确保网络接口处于活动状态,并检查防火墙设置。
- 图形界面缺失:某些Linux发行版默认未安装图形界面工具,可手动安装或使用命令行方式操作。
六、注意事项
- 使用Sniffer工具时,需遵守相关法律法规,不得非法监听他人网络通信。
- 在企业环境中使用前,应获得授权,避免造成不必要的法律风险。
结语
Sniffer作为一款强大的网络分析工具,不仅有助于网络性能优化,还能在安全防护方面发挥重要作用。通过本文的指导,相信您已经掌握了Sniffer的基本安装与使用方法。在今后的实际应用中,建议结合具体需求灵活选择工具,并不断积累实践经验,提升自身的网络分析能力。